昨天做的事:1.在顶层容器中使用方法setMenuBar()嵌入菜单条,再使用方法setContentPane()嵌入中间容器。 2.利用JButton中的addActionListener(new ActionListener(){})方法对按钮添加事件,在new ActionListener() ...
分类:
其他好文 时间:
2016-04-20 08:14:23
阅读次数:
154
事件处理: ActionEvent && WindowEvent: ActionEvent -- 包含一个ACTION_PERFORMED。触发的动作有单击button,双击选项,选择指定菜单项,回车键输入等。 addActionListener(<al>) -- al ->ActionListen ...
分类:
编程语言 时间:
2016-04-11 12:17:33
阅读次数:
216
Java 8中Lambda表达式就是一个函数接口,也就是只有一个抽象方法的接口。Java中,传递一个行为是通过传递一个代表某种行为的对象来实现,比如,需要给某个按钮注册一个事件监听:button.addActionListener(new ActionListener() { @Overrid...
分类:
编程语言 时间:
2016-01-01 12:50:42
阅读次数:
153
JAVA中的Swing组件,按钮的重点是进行事件的监听,可以通过调用JButton的addActionListener()方法。这个方法接受一个实现ActionListener接口的对象作为参数,ActionListener接口中只包含一个actionPerformed()方法,所以如果想把事件处理...
分类:
编程语言 时间:
2015-10-28 18:50:55
阅读次数:
590
java-事件处理机制
一 处理基本要素
1 事件源
b1 = new JButton("按钮1");
b2 = new JButton("按钮2");
2 事件处理对象
关联事件,注册监听事件源
b1.addActionListener(at);
TestAction
at = new TestAction()
...
分类:
编程语言 时间:
2015-05-23 15:37:08
阅读次数:
133
计算器一个接口,一个函数 参数用数组实现,参数个数可变,查看源码也可以从jre包中查看box grid布局管理器Box : creatVerticalBox JScrollPaneJSplitPaneJTreeJTableJava事件驱动模型button.addActionListener(/...
分类:
编程语言 时间:
2014-12-03 13:58:44
阅读次数:
207
学习处理事件时,必须很好的掌握事件源,监视器,处理事件的接口 1.事件源 能够产生java认可事件的对象都可称为事件源,也就是说事件源必须是对象 2.监视器 监视事件源,以便对发生的事件做出处理 如:对文本框,这个方法为: addActionListener(监视器); 3.处理事件的接口 为了让监...
分类:
编程语言 时间:
2014-11-20 09:02:06
阅读次数:
209
.NET中把“事件”看作一个基本的编程概念,并提供了非常优美的语法支持,对比如下C#和Java代码可以看出两种语言设计思想之间的差异。// C#someButton.Click += OnSomeButtonClick;复制代码// JavasomeButton.addActionListener(...
分类:
Web程序 时间:
2014-11-19 10:34:43
阅读次数:
190
.NET中把“事件”看作一个基本的编程概念,并提供了非常优美的语法支持,对比如下C#和Java代码可以看出两种语言设计思想之间的差异。// C#someButton.Click += OnSomeButtonClick;// JavasomeButton.addActionListener( ...
分类:
Web程序 时间:
2014-09-11 23:38:12
阅读次数:
201
1.ActionListener是处理被点击的事件的。除了像之前每个元素都独立写一个listener之外,还可以统一用一个s.setActionCommand("sec");
m.setActionCommand("min");
s.addActionListener(newSetHandler());
m.addActionListener(newSetHandler());
privatefinalclassSetHandlerim..
分类:
编程语言 时间:
2014-05-27 03:39:56
阅读次数:
213